Renovation of a municipal facility in Duluth, Minnesota. Completed plans call for the renovation of a municipal facility.
Work pertains to the installation of a new boiler system at the St. Louis County Courthouse located in Duluth, Minnesota. Each response must be accompanied by a certified check or bid bond prepared on separate form of bid bond, duly executed by the Responder as principal and having as surety thereon, a surety company approved by County, in the amount of five percent (5%) of the response. Such certified checks or bid bonds will be returned to all except the three (3) lowest Responsible Responders within three (3) days after the public opening. The remaining certified checks or bid bonds will be returned promptly after Owner and the accepted Responder have executed the contract, or if no award has been made, within five (5) days or upon demand of the Responder at any time thereafter, so long as Responder has not been notified of the acceptance of their response. For any contract over $150,000.00, St. Louis County will require the successful Responder to furnish a Performance Bond and a Labor & Materials Payment Bond in the full amounts in favour of Owner. The surety company providing the bond(s) must be registered to do business in the State of Minnesota and be satisfactory to the Owner. Any attorney-in-fact who signs bid bonds or contract bonds must file with each bond, a certified and effectively dated copy of their power of attorney. The successful Responder, upon failure or refusal to deliver the bonds required within ten (10) days after receipt of notification of the acceptance of its response, shall forfeit to County the security deposited with the response as liquidated damages for such failure or refusal.
